Loomis, FEICASE and FEPAN: Security, Cash and Payments for Businesses

Loomis renews its collaboration agreements with FEICASE and FEPAN to continue bringing food, retail, hospitality and catering businesses security, cash management and integrated payment solutions that improve operational efficiency and business control.

Cash Apr 14, 2026

We are renewing our collaboration agreements with FEICASE and FEPAN to continue bringing specialized solutions to food, retail, hospitality and catering businesses that improve security, operational efficiency and control over collections and payments. 

 

At Loomis, we know that security, traceability and efficiency in cash management remain key factors for thousands of businesses that deal every day with collections, payments, tills, valuables and in-person transactions. 

 

In sectors such as food, retail, hospitality, catering or bread making, every till close, every cash collection and every point-of-sale transaction has a direct impact on profitability, internal organization and the customer experience

 

That's why we have renewed our collaboration agreements with FEICASE and FEPAN, two business associations linked to the productive and commercial fabric of Seville. With these renewals, we strengthen a relationship built on trust, sector-specific closeness and a shared goal: helping businesses better manage their cash, valuables and payments.

Security and efficiency for businesses that handle cash and valuables 

Cash management remains an essential part of many businesses' operations. Not only because of the volume of cash payments still made in certain sectors, but also because cash requires specific procedures to avoid losses, errors, internal risks and unnecessary exposure for staff

 

Outsourcing processes such as cash-in-transit, custody, counting or sorting allows businesses to gain peace of mind and dedicate their internal resources to what truly creates value: serving customers better, selling more, producing efficiently and growing the business. 

 

As a company authorized for activities regulated under Spain's Private Security Law (Ley 5/2014), at Loomis we provide services related to the deposit, custody, counting and sorting of coins and banknotes, securities, jewelry, precious metals, antiques, works of art and other items requiring special surveillance and protection, as well as their transport and distribution

 

For businesses affiliated with FEICASE and FEPAN, having Loomis as a partner brings concrete benefits: 

 

 

Greater security in cash and valuables management. 

Processes involving money and valuable assets require protocols, resources and specialized expertise. We help reduce the business's and its employees' exposure in sensitive operations. 

 

More control and traceability. 

Professional cash management makes it possible to organize cash flows, improve tracking of transactions and reduce uncertainty at closing time. 

 

Less internal operational burden. 

When cash handling becomes a manual, recurring task, it consumes time and resources. Delegating this part of the operation allows teams to focus on customer service, production, sales or business management. 

 

Stronger compliance and professionalization. 

Working with a provider specialized in regulated activities helps businesses rely on procedures aligned with demanding security and control standards. 

 

 

Loomis Pay: integrated payments for hospitality, catering and retail

Beyond our cash management and cash-in-transit solutions, these agreements also let us bring the sector the value of Loomis Pay, our line of payment and management solutions for physical businesses. 

 

In hospitality, catering and retail, the moment of payment is much more than a transaction. It's an essential part of the customer experience and a critical source of information for the business. 

 

A slow payment, a till discrepancy, a poorly connected order or manual reconciliation can create errors, wasted time and friction for both staff and the end customer. 

 

With Loomis Pay, we help bars, cafés, restaurants, shops and other in-person businesses integrate their payments, improve point-of-sale operations and get a clearer view of their sales, payments and closes. 

 

Our proposal makes it possible to move toward a more connected management of physical and digital payments, reducing manual tasks and enabling a more agile, secure and controlled operation.

Benefits for bars, restaurants, cafés and food businesses 

The value of Loomis Pay is especially clear when we bring it into the day-to-day of the business. 

 

A restaurant needs to take payments quickly in the dining room and on the terrace. A café needs quick turnover during peak hours. A bakery or food shop needs to control sales, cash and payments without adding complexity. A restaurant group needs visibility and reliable data to make better decisions. 

 

In all of these cases, an integrated solution can help: 

 

Speed up service during peak demand. 

Payment at the table, integrated card readers and connection with the POS help reduce waiting times and improve turnover. 

 

Reduce errors and discrepancies. 

When payments are connected to the POS and the till, manual tasks decrease and the daily close becomes easier. 

 

Improve reconciliation of payments and sales. 

Integrating the POS, card reader and cash management gives a more organized view of the business's activity. 

 

Give the team more autonomy. 

Handheld order terminals, portable POS units and payment devices allow staff to serve, take payments and print receipts from different points in the venue. 

 

Make better business decisions. 

A connected system makes it easier to access information on sales, closes, products, shifts and operational performance.
